* [PATCH 2/4] test-lib.sh: preserve GIT_TRACE_CURL from the environment
2016-09-05 10:24 [PATCH 0/4] test suite: use the GIT_TRACE_CURL environment var Elia Pinto
2016-09-05 10:24 ` [PATCH 1/4] t5541-http-push-smart.sh: " Elia Pinto
@ 2016-09-05 10:24 ` Elia Pinto
2016-09-05 10:24 ` [PATCH 3/4] t5550-http-fetch-dumb.sh: use the GIT_TRACE_CURL environment var Elia Pinto
2016-09-05 10:24 ` [PATCH 4/4] t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h: " Elia Pinto
3 siblings, 0 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Elia Pinto @ 2016-09-05 10:24 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: git; +Cc: Elia Pinto
Turning on this variable can be useful when debugging http
tests. It can break a few tests in t5541 if not set
to an absolute path but it is not a variable
that the user is likely to have enabled accidentally.
Signed-off-by: Elia Pinto <gitter.spiros@gmail.com>
---
t/test-lib.sh |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/t/test-lib.sh b/t/test-lib.sh
index d731d66..986eba1 100644
--- a/t/test-lib.sh
+++ b/t/test-lib.sh
@@ -89,6 +89,7 @@ unset VISUAL EMAIL LANGUAGE COLUMNS $("$PERL_PATH" -e '
UNZIP
PERF_
CURL_VERBOSE
+ TRACE_CURL
));
my @vars = grep(/^GIT_/ && !/^GIT_($ok)/o, @env);
print join("\n", @vars);

* [PATCH 4/4] t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h: use the GIT_TRACE_CURL environment var
2016-09-05 10:24 [PATCH 0/4] test suite: use the GIT_TRACE_CURL environment var Elia Pinto
` (2 preceding siblings ...)
2016-09-05 10:24 ` [PATCH 3/4] t5550-http-fetch-dumb.sh: use the GIT_TRACE_CURL environment var Elia Pinto
@ 2016-09-05 10:24 ` Elia Pinto
3 siblings, 0 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Elia Pinto @ 2016-09-05 10:24 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: git; +Cc: Elia Pinto
Use the new GIT_TRACE_CURL environment variable instead
of the deprecated GIT_CURL_VERBOSE.
Signed-off-by: Elia Pinto <gitter.spiros@gmail.com>
---
t/t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h | 15 ++++++++++++---
1 file changed, 12 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/t/t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h b/t/t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h
index 2f375eb..1ec5b27 100755
--- a/t/t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h
+++ b/t/t5551-http-fetch-smart.sh
@@ -43,12 +43,21 @@ cat >exp <<EOF
< Content-Type: application/x-git-upload-pack-result
EOF
test_expect_success 'clone http repository' '
- GIT_CURL_VERBOSE=1 git clone --quiet $HTTPD_URL/smart/repo.git clone 2>err &&
+ GIT_TRACE_CURL=true git clone --quiet $HTTPD_URL/smart/repo.git clone 2>err &&
test_cmp file clone/file &&
tr '\''\015'\'' Q <err |
sed -e "
s/Q\$//
/^[*] /d
+ /^== Info:/d
+ /^=> Send header, /d
+ /^=> Send header:$/d
+ /^<= Recv header, /d
+ /^<= Recv header:$/d
+ s/=> Send header: //
+ s/= Recv header://
+ /^<= Recv data/d
+ /^=> Send data/d
/^$/d
/^< $/d
@@ -261,9 +270,9 @@ test_expect_success CMDLINE_LIMIT \
'
test_expect_success 'large fetch-pack requests can be split across POSTs' '
- GIT_CURL_VERBOSE=1 git -c http.postbuffer=65536 \
+ GIT_TRACE_CURL=true git -c http.postbuffer=65536 \
clone --bare "$HTTPD_URL/smart/repo.git" split.git 2>err &&
- grep "^> POST" err >posts &&
+ grep "^=> Send header: POST" err >posts &&
test_line_count = 2 posts
'
